Advanced Avionics Equipments



Advanced Avionics Systems play a critical function in enhancing the operational abilities and safety of UH-60 helicopters. These systems encompass a large array of modern technologies that give pilots with essential details, boost situational recognition, and improve objective execution. Among the crucial parts of sophisticated avionics is the Integrated Multi-Function Show (IMFD), which consolidates crucial flight information onto a solitary display. The IMFD offers real-time information on airplane efficiency, engine specifications, navigation information, and sensor inputs, allowing pilots to make informed choices rapidly. In addition, UH-60 helicopters are furnished with advanced interaction systems that allow seamless sychronisation with various other airplane, ground control terminals, and command centers. This makes certain efficient interaction throughout objectives, enhancing functional effectiveness and security. One more vital function of innovative avionics is the electronic flight control system, which makes it possible for precise and secure trip control, even in tough conditions. This system gives pilots with automated flight settings, such as auto-pilot and security augmentation, additional enhancing the safety and security and operational capacities of the UH-60 helicopter. To conclude, progressed avionics systems are essential to the UH-60 helicopter, giving pilots with enhanced situational understanding, interaction capabilities, and flight control, inevitably enhancing functional effectiveness and safety.

Innovative Engine Style



Enhancing the overall efficiency and performance of the UH-60 helicopter, the cutting-edge engine design revolutionizes its propulsion system. The UH-60 helicopter is outfitted with her latest blog twin General Electric T700 turboshaft engines, which supply exceptional power and reliability. These engines are understood for their sophisticated design and cutting-edge technology, making them one of one of the most effective and efficient engines in the market.


The ingenious engine layout of the UH-60 includes numerous essential features that add to its superior efficiency. One of these features is the Complete Authority Digital Engine Control (FADEC) system, which maximizes the engine's performance by continually checking and changing various specifications such as gas flow, temperature level, and stress. This ensures that the his response engine operates at its peak performance, resulting in boosted fuel intake and lowered emissions.


Furthermore, the UH-60's engines are geared up with a dual-channel engine health monitoring system, which constantly monitors the engine's performance and provides real-time feedback to the pilots. This enables very early discovery of any kind of possible problems or abnormalities, allowing prompt maintenance and stopping expensive engine failings.


Additionally, the UH-60's engines are created with improved toughness and integrity in mind. They are geared up with sophisticated materials and finishes that improve resistance to use, rust, and heats. This makes certain prolonged engine life and reduces maintenance demands, leading to reduced downtime and boosted objective availability.


Revolutionary Safety And Security Functions



With a focus on guaranteeing the utmost safety and security for its crew and travelers, the UH-60 helicopter incorporates a variety of cutting edge functions. In addition, the UH-60 is equipped with a sophisticated fly-by-wire trip control system, which boosts maneuverability and reduces the threat of pilot-induced mishaps.


Another crucial safety and security function is the crash-resistant gas system. Designed to hold up against effect forces, the gas tanks are self-sealing and surrounded by a layer of foam that prevents gas leak during a mishap. This considerably lowers the risk of fire and surge, boosting the possibilities of survival for the crew and travelers.




In Addition, the UH-60 incorporates advanced crashworthy seats, particularly developed to lessen the impact pressures on owners throughout a crash or hard touchdown (uh 60). These seats are crafted to absorb energy and minimize the danger of injury, providing an added layer of protection to the staff and passengers
